Output 7d51ad7af81dde4e943348626ada43d4be0ae1ba33542b5eac51b46f8d4b358e:21

value
1990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a74715d05fc96a2bd8b8da42be8256a3cb25b766 OP_EQUAL
address
3GwVvfcFSuvziyUSFsknFW3tbaozUZHJ64
transaction
7d51ad7af81dde4e943348626ada43d4be0ae1ba33542b5eac51b46f8d4b358e
spent
true